New Delhi’s funding ‘Okay’ but political solution must: Omar
2/28/2011 9:28:45 PM
Early Times Report
SRINAGAR, Feb 28: Pinning hope that dialogue process between various shades of the opinion and Interlocutors would be result oriented, Chief Minister Omar Abdullah once again underlined importance of resolving political issues politically.
“From the day one I took office, I am advocating for addressing of political issues in a peaceful and conducive atmosphere through the process of dialogue,” he said and referred his continuous endeavours in this direction. Addressing a mammoth public gathering at Magam in district Baramulla of Kashmir Valley on Monday, Omar said that he has highlighted importance of resolving political issues of Jammu and Kashmir before the Prime Minister and UPA Chairperson within and outside the state.
“I told in categorical terms that financial help to the state is indeed a welcome gesture for which we are thankful to the centre government but the political issues require political addressing”, he said adding that giving due weightage to this aspect, central government constituted the institution of Interlocutors to deal with issues of political nature.
Chief Minister said that the union home minister in the Parliament has made it clear that accession of Jammu and Kashmir to the Indian Union has been unique as such its political addressing should also be unique. “We are hopeful that dialogue process would be result-oriented,” he said. On the Rehabilitation Policy, Chief Minister said that his government has provided legal mechanism for those who have crossed over to other side of LoC during militancy and want to return as peaceful persons and live a normal life.
“Some 600 applications have been received from these persons so far which are being scrutinized”, he added. “Our endeavour is to create peaceful atmosphere and safeguard the future of the state,” he said adding that his party would continue to strive for internal autonomy of the state.
